WebSep 16, 2024 · Port dwell time is the amount of time which cargo or ships spend within a port. It is a key indicator of how efficiently a port is operating, how quickly cargo is flowing through its terminals and how long a ship is spending in port. WebThe turnaround time (TRT or TAT) of the ships in a port and dwell time of cargo are considered to be the two primary indicators of a port’s performance (Chung, 1993; Dasgupta & Sinha, 2016). The former is the time a ship spends in a port while the latter shows the time a consignment stays in a port. WebPort productivity discussions often use vessel time in port—referred to as dwell time, turnaround time, or berth time—as a primary metric. This emphasis implies a need to understand the factors that determine dwell time, especially in port comparisons. Previous dwell time analyses have been handicapped by limited data.
